    The Aviation Industry India

    The Aviation Industry By Ambika Vij History The beginning of aviation in India was made when Henri Piquet carried 6500 mails in a biplane between Allahabad and Naini. This is also considered as the world’s first airmail service[1]. Thereafter in December 1912, the first domestic air route opened between Karachi and Delhi.     The United States Steel Industry

    The United States steel industry For decades, the United States steel industry was in deep economic malaise. The problems of the industry were numerous. Beginning in the 1970s , falling trade barriers allowed cost-efficient foreign producers to sell steel in the United States , and they were taking market share away from once dominant integrated steel makers, such as U.S. Steel, Bethlehem Steel, and Wheeling-Pittsburg.
